What is Mediation and why is the Virginia Workers Compensation Commission Pushing Mediation?

Mediations has several key components.

  • There is a mediator who is trained to try to resolved disputes. The mediator is a neutral third party—in Virginia usually an active or retired Deputy Commissioner— who discusses the issues and tries to reach an overall agreement.
  • Mediation is confidential—nothing discussed in mediation is admissible in a hearing, unless it is otherwise discoverable.
  • Mediation tries to address the future needs of the parties rather to assess fault or blame.
  • Mediation allows the parties to have control over the process. The parties have the sole power to reach an agreement. The mediator does not make any formal decisions.
  • The Commission believes that the employee and employer are in the best position to discuss their issues and to try to resolve them.
  • Mediation can take place by phone as well as in person
  • Mediation is a much faster process than litigation.
